#059bf4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#059bf4 is composed of 2% red, 60.8% green and 95.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 98% cyan, 36.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 202.3 degrees, a saturation of 96% and a lightness of 48.8%. #059bf4 color hex could be obtained by blending #0affff with #0037e9. Closest websafe color is: #0099ff.

Shades and Tints of #059bf4

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#00080d is the darkest color, while #f9fdff is the lightest one.

Tones of #059bf4

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#787e81 is the less saturated color, while #059bf4 is the most saturated one.
